Flying Spades[1] areenemies inWario World. They are encountered inPecan Sands only. These flying shovel enemies are rather likeMonstrous Magnets; they fly using tiny insect wings, andWario can get to higher places by throwing them headfirst into a soft section of dirt on a wall. They also make the same echoing metal sound upon being knocked down.
